Pharmacist here. I want to add the drug interaction perspective on the pharmacology.

Key points from a pharmacokinetic standpoint:

  • GLP-1 agonists delay gastric emptying, which can affect Tmax of co-administered oral medications
  • Monitor patients on warfarin (INR), levothyroxine (TSH), and oral contraceptives during dose titration
  • The albumin-binding mechanism of semaglutide (C-18 fatty acid linker) gives it the ~168-hour half-life that enables weekly dosing
  • Steady state is reached at approximately 4-5 weeks after dose initiation or adjustment

Amycretin (AMY/GLP-1 dual agonist) emerging data relevant to the pharmacology: Phase 1 showed -13.1% body weight at only 12 weeks, the fastest trajectory ever seen for an anti-obesity agent[1].

Amylin receptor agonism enhances satiety signaling through the area postrema and reduces glucagon secretion. Combined with GLP-1R agonism, this dual mechanism may produce even greater efficacy than current agents.

Early-stage data — interpret with caution. But the trajectory is extraordinary.

Semaglutide structural biology relevant to the pharmacology: semaglutide is a 31-amino acid peptide with 94% homology to native GLP-1(7-36). Three key modifications enable its pharmacokinetic profile:

  1. Aib8 substitution: DPP-4 resistance (prevents enzymatic degradation)
  2. Arg34 substitution: improved chemical stability
  3. C18 fatty diacid at Lys26: albumin binding → long half-life

These three modifications transform a peptide with a 2-minute half-life (native GLP-1) into one with a 168-hour half-life (semaglutide). A masterclass in peptide engineering.
